For homeowners transitioning to solar-plus-storage systems, the choice of step-up or step-down transformation equipment often determines long-term system viability. The S13 Single Phase Oil Immersed Electrical Transformer carries a 15–20% price premium over older S11/MVA-class units, yet its adoption in distributed solar storage is accelerating. Lugao Power has field-tested these units across 200+ residential microgrid installations, and the data reveals a compelling total-cost-of-ownership story that transcends the initial invoice.
| Component | S11 (Conventional) | S13 Single Phase Oil Immersed Electrical Transformer |
|---|---|---|
| Core material | Standard grain-oriented steel | High-permeability amorphous/nano-crystalline strip |
| Winding design | Circular concentric | Foil-wound or helical with improved fill factor |
| Loss guarantee | IEC 60076 (Tier 2) | Tier 1 with 30% lower guaranteed losses |
| Average price (10 kVA) | $420–480 | $580–650 |
The premium primarily funds lower core flux density and enhanced oil circulation channels—engineering choices that directly impact 25-year performance.
For a typical 8 kW residential PV + 15 kWh battery system, the S13 Single Phase Oil Immersed Electrical Transformer operates 6–8 hours daily at 40–60% load. Using Lugao Power’s field logs:
S11 no-load loss: 85 W
S13 no-load loss: 58 W (saving 0.66 kWh/day)
S11 load loss at 60%: 210 W
S13 load loss at 60%: 148 W (saving 0.50 kWh/day)
Total daily saving ≈ 1.16 kWh. At $0.18/kWh (U.S. average), annual saving = $76. Over 15 years = $1,140—nearly double the upfront gap. Add inverter-clipping reduction (lower impedance means 2–3% more harvested energy during cloud-edge events), and the S13 Single Phase Oil Immersed Electrical Transformer becomes cash-positive by year 4.

Q1: Can the S13 Single Phase Oil Immersed Electrical Transformer handle daily deep-cycling between grid-tied and off-grid modes without degrading faster than a standard unit?
A: Yes. The S13’s core is designed with low remanence flux (≤0.15 T residual), which means each re-energization after a grid outage does not cause inrush current spikes above 8× rated—compared to 12–14× for S11. Over 5,000 such cycles (typical for 15-year storage life), the winding hot-spot temperature stays within Class A limits (105°C) because of optimized oil ducting. Lugao Power’s accelerated aging test (ASTM D1934) shows insulation life reduction <2% after 8,000 cycles, whereas standard units lose 9–11%. For residential use, this translates to full rated capacity through year 18 without rewind.
Q2: What is the real-world efficiency at partial loads (20–30%) during cloudy days, and does it drop below 96%?
A: The S13 Single Phase Oil Immersed Electrical Transformer maintains 97.2% efficiency at 25% load (measured per IEEE C57.123). This is because the core loss dominates at low load, and the S13’s amorphous strip reduces that loss by 40% vs. conventional M4 steel. Even at 10% load (nighttime standby for battery trickle-charge), efficiency stays at 95.8%—still above the U.S. DOE 2016 minimum for distribution transformers. Lugao Power provides a load-efficiency curve with every unit; actual field data from Arizona (high PV penetration) shows annual weighted efficiency of 97.6%, beating the nameplate guarantee by 0.3%.
Q3: How does the oil expansion system work in a sealed S13 unit, and will I need to top up oil every season?
A: The S13 Single Phase Oil Immersed Electrical Transformer uses a nitrogen-blanketed sealed tank with a corrugated wall that expands/contracts thermally. There is no conservator or breather—so oil never contacts atmospheric moisture or oxygen. Under normal operation (-25°C to +50°C ambient), the oil volume change (≈8% from cold to hot) is fully absorbed by the corrugations’ elastic deformation. Topping up is never required unless there’s a leak (warranty covers leaks for 5 years). Lugao Power pressure-tests each tank at 0.3 MPa for 24 hours; field return rate for oil-level issues is 0.2% over 7 years—effectively a maintenance-free design.
